Unnamed character in the extended 'Return of the King'?
Hi
In Rotk - the movie. When the attack on the black gates is starting. Aragorn, Gimli, Legolas, Gandalf, Pippin, Merry etc. is talking to the.. whatever it is.. by the gates, who tells them that Frodo is dead.. Who is that? |

Welcome to the Downs Thinelen
It is Mouth of Sauron - the placekeeper, or lieutenant of Sauron. Living man, probably Númenorean, in the service of Dark Lord.
